    "Man, born from the seven, was strong, wise, and resourceful, but he was born into an unforgiving world. An inevitable darkness — creatures of destruction — the creatures of sin - set their sights on man and all the sevens creations!" The mad septon spun his tale. "These forces clashed, and it seemed the unending darkness was intent on returning man's brief existence to the void..." The man continued. A small crowed had gathered to listen to his story, long winded and strange as it was. Ser Harras thought these seven folk a queer lot; praying to stone idles and fat men with large purses. What gods needed coin? "However," the septon kept talking. "even the smallest spark of hope is enough to ignite change, and in time, man's faith, resourcefulness, and ingenuity led them to victory against the hordes of shadow!"

    Yup. The man was nuts, although he seemed alone in that realization. The crowd had increased.

    "Faith in hand, man lit their way through the darkness!" The man was waving his hands around casually, as if swatting at some fly that only he could see. "In the shadow's absence came strength, civilization, and most importantly, faith. But even the most brilliant lights eventually flicker and die. And when the faithful are gone... darkness will return..."

    Heh. That took a dark turn quickly, but he supposed fear was a good motivator. Perhaps there was some hope that yet lingered for these greenlan-

    "The lords and kings may prepare their guardians and build monuments of their pride," the septon spoke with no small drip of malice. His voice oddly cold and grasping. "but take heed those of the faithful that remain among us... there will be no victory in sin! The time has come to repent our ways! The darkness is coming for us all!" It seemed best to leave this one to his ramblings...

    Harras kept his hood up, hiding his features under the shroud. He was invited, truly he was, but he knew better than to trust the summons of these greenlander types. Saying nothing of the religious fanatics that could brand him a heretic at any moment. "Lovely people." He smirked under the hood, moving away from the ramblings of a mad man. The last words he heard from the septon was of the Wall and Ice and Death and who knew what else.

    Walking through the crowd of some thousand strong he made his way to the great sept of Baelor, grand in it's scale, a thing of beauty that the drowned god would doubtless scoff at. "So this is what gods need coin for eh?" Harras smirked, greedy septons. In truth half of these ones seemed to wear rags while the other half unblemished steel freshly forged and untested. His own was lighter, and to be frankly he liked it that way. Cant kill what you cant hit. His own chest was plated with no ordinary steel either. His was of valyrian design, according to Euron at least, and any sane man knew better than to argue to that ones face. The mad crow called it valyrian steel? Harras bloody well believed it. In public at least. In practice? It seemed as good steel as any other, and light too.

    The trial by seven, as the faith so inventively called it, was being held outside the steps of Baelor with a crowd of faithful onlookers (who most certainly were not there just to see a group of people cut each other to pieces) waiting eagerly for the trial to begin. Harras stood in the crowd, unnoticed and uncaring. He'd stay there too until he was certain this wasn't a trap. He'd no intention of dying and losing his family steel nor Lord Drumms either.

    By the drowned god, that mans face was beyond hilarious...

    "Give me that!" Euron had barked, a snarl on his lips as he grabbed Red Rain out from Lord Drumms hands.

    "I-" Harras had been lost for words. Euron unclasped his armor and handed him it along with another houses blade. This was, needless to say, bloody odd.

    "Take these," the King had commanded. "and go murder some people for me."

    Euron left without explaining who exactly he wanted dead. He also failed to explain where those people were. It took some words the following morning where the King had laughed and claimed he'd completely forgotten the details; jumping into a long winded tale that vaguely explained his plans. "He's mad." Harras muttered to himself, standing in the crowd of impatient onlookers.

    The plan was mad. None could say Harras was a liability, as nobody would believe the plan even if he felt like telling, such was the randomness to it all. Honestly? He wasn't sure if Euron Greyjoy was insane or a genius. Perhaps both? He was dangerous. That much he'd accepted. And so with that thought the Knight of Grey Garden sighed and waited for the trial. He might die here. The thought hadn't alluded him. He just didn't care. It would be a good fight.

    Ser Harras waited. He waited and waited and waited some more. Would these seven gods hurry up already?

    From his vantage point overlooking the Water Gardens, Doran Martell looked at the children at play in the pool below. All around him, overripe blood oranges ominously fell from trees, giving off a sickly-sweet odor as they split open upon impact. While Doran watched, Dorne was angry — angry at the recent death of Oberyn Martell, angry at the murders of Elia Martell and her children at the end of Robert’s Rebellion
    . Doran Martell knew all this, and yet from all appearances, he did nothing.

    The reality, though, could not have been more different. Doran Martell was doing something to avenge his lost loved ones, but the prince could not seek the immediate vengeance that his family and countrymen wanted. The Prince knew that if Dorne went to war against the Iron Throne, they would lose, and if they lost, it would be the children who would suffer.

    However, events had finally shaped up to the point where Doran Martell felt that he had his chance to truly strike a blow for vengeance all the while avoiding deaths like those of his sister and her children so many years before. One of those he had sought vengeance for had returned, his nephew now of age and a true man had come to reclaim what he believed his. This turn of events had not been expected, it was however, not unwelcome. With the young Prince returned Doran had a true vessel with which to drive forward and put his, and Dorne’s, thirst for vengeance to a better cause.

    Arianne had met her cousin on her father’s instructions and had informed Doran of her impressions of him, she was a guest at his court now and had refused Doran’s multiple requests for her to return to Dorne. She had always been stubborn, but perhaps it is good for her to spend some time away from Dorne. Once assured that Aegon Targaryen was who he claimed to be Doran could adapt his plans and make preparations for the future.

    After only a short exchange with the boy and his advisors it was agreed that the spears of Dorne would back the returning Prince Aegon Targaryen and so Doran Martell, Prince of Dorne has been named Hand to his nephew. Previously Doran had avoided any political influence in the capital, despite many correspondences between his brother-in-law and himself many years ago where Prince Rhaegar had attempted to have Doran join his father’s council. Doran had always refused the Prince’s invitations, he knew of King Aerys’ madness and he did not believe he could be the difference maker in his already tainted reign. Perhaps he could’ve made a difference, perhaps he could’ve persuaded Aerys to show mercy to Lord Stark and his heir, perhaps Jon Arryn would not have called his banners in Robert’s name and perhaps Elia and sweet Rhaenys would not have been murdered. These thoughts had plagued Doran’s mind for some time after the end of Robert’s Rebellion, but Doran knew it did him no good to dwell on the past and what might’ve been.

    Doran had decided to accept the position of Hand as a gesture of goodwill and remembrance of Prince Rhaegar, the King that Doran had intended to serve under once his reign began. Oh how close that time was before Rhaegar became distracted by prophecy and his reckless actions led to the downfall of his House, just as he was to restore the image of House Targaryen. What Rhaegar had planned would never come to pass and so is of no importance now, but in his son, Aegon, Rhaegar’s vision for a revitalised Westeros can come to pass and Doran will do all he can to see it through.
